Subject: Cut-over complete — Lenswick diff viewer for large files

Hello plugin authors,

The cut-over to the new Lenswick diff engine finished last night. Large files (over the chunking threshold) are now diffed server-side in streamed segments, so plugins receive partial hunks rather than a full buffer. If your plugin assumed whole-file access, please review the updated hook lifecycle before your next release. Rendering hooks now fire per segment, in order. For verification, the production configuration now reads as follows.

deployment values, kajep-kageg:
[praix]
host = praix.paliqcorp.corp
user = praix_svc
database = praix_prod

Handover note — Crumbwheel order cutoffs.

Welcome aboard. The bakery cutoff rule in Crumbwheel closes same-day orders at 14:00 local to each storefront, not UTC — this has bitten us twice. Holiday overrides live in the calendar service and take precedence silently, so always check there first when a cutoff looks wrong. To unlock the calendar service's admin console after a restart, enter the recovery passphrase below.

vault phrase of bagap-bahaf = silion-pelox-sorox-casdor-quenwyn-fraax-eliox-praael-kelion-quenvan-kasox-rusael-norius-belvan

Q: How does the Furrowline TG-4 gateway buffer telemetry when a tractor leaves coverage? A: The unit stores up to 72 hours of sensor readings locally, then replays them in timestamp order once connectivity resumes. Do not power-cycle during replay, as partial batches may duplicate. For provisioning credentials or replay-conflict questions, contact the Hedgerow Agri support team.

escalation mailbox, yajeg-bageg: quenax.olidor@lumiccorp.internal

- [ ] Basement archive orientation: Walk the new starter down to the Hollowmere archive room (level B1, past the plant room) and explain the sign-out ledger for boxed files. Emphasise that the door must never be propped open, as the room is climate-controlled. Reception staff should verify the starter's badge is active before the visit. The door-pass code for the archive is:

badge for hahip-bagag: bdg-FIJ-9